We purchasd a home in September 2015 (3.5 months ago), and because the home inspection report stated that many of the items (furnace, hot water heater, et. al.) were at the end of their expected life, we had the former owners pay for the home warranty. All was sort of okay, until the furnace died. We had used the furnace for a couple of weeks at the beginning of November and right before Thanksgiving, it died. We had scheduled a maintenance call the day after it died the Wednesday before Thanksgiving. The HVAC folks doing the maintenance, stated that there was really no way to fix it; the entire unit (heat pump) and compressor needed to be replaced. We had to wait for the HWA vendor to come out to check it the same day, and he said the same thing - it needed to be replaced completely. So we went to stay with my mother - 3 hours away. We called HWA in the car on Friday and kept calling - their vendor had not filed the report yet, so we had to keep waiting.
My husband is 69 years old with diabetes and I am 63 (we are now considered "elderly"), and the house was down to 53 degrees at this point. HWA said we had to wait until their contractor could file his report. We took the decision to have it replaced - what were we supposed to do at that point? It took until Monday, when they called back (now since Wednesday before). I told them I wanted to cash out this part of the policy - and they offered approximately $970.00. The new system cost $6,700! I asked them where they could purchase a new furnace for that amount. The response was that they were going to try and fix it first (even thought 2 HVAC specialists said there was no point), and that we would have to wait for parts to be ordered and then they would see about fixing it. Seriously?? This is a complete rip-off and I cannot believe that they expected us to stay in a cold house with no heat for more than a week, whilst they tried to order parts for a system that was more than 30 years old, and we were supposed to live there. This is unconscionable and they need to repay us the cost of a new furnace system.
